According to the hardwareDB Benchmark, the GeForce RTX 2080 SUPER GPU is faster than the GeForce RTX 4060 in gaming.
Our database shows that the GeForce RTX 4060 has a slightly higher core clock speed. This is the frequency at which the graphics core is running at. While not necessarily an indicator of overall performance, this metric can be useful when comparing two GPUs based on the same architecture. In addition, the GeForce RTX 4060 also has a slightly higher boost clock speed. The boost clock speed is the frequency that the GPU core can reach if the temperature is low enough. The allows for higher performance in certain scenarios.
In addition, the GeForce RTX 4060 has a slightly lower TDP at 200 W when compared to the GeForce RTX 2080 SUPER at 250 W. Heat output doesn't match power consumption directly but, it's a good estimate.
